The Importance Of Avuncular DNA Testing

Avuncular DNA testing, also known as “aunt-uncle testing,” is a type of DNA test that determines the likelihood of a biological relationship between an individual and their aunt or uncle This form of testing can be crucial in cases where the alleged biological parents are unavailable for testing, or in situations where there is uncertainty about the lineage of an individual Avuncular DNA testing can provide important answers and help individuals in various legal, medical, and personal situations.

The process of avuncular DNA testing involves comparing the DNA of the aunt or uncle with the DNA of the niece or nephew While a standard paternity test compares the DNA of a father and child, avuncular testing compares the DNA of a sibling with the DNA of a niece or nephew Through this comparison, a geneticist can determine the likelihood of a biological relationship between the tested individuals.

There are several scenarios where avuncular DNA testing may be necessary For example, if a child’s parents are deceased or unavailable for testing, the child may need to establish maternity or paternity through testing with their parents’ siblings Similarly, individuals who are looking to sponsor a niece or nephew for immigration purposes may need to prove the biological relationship through avuncular DNA testing Additionally, avuncular testing can be used in cases of adoption, inheritance disputes, and to establish or confirm biological relationships in complex family situations.

Avuncular DNA testing can also play a significant role in legal matters such as inheritance disputes or custody cases In situations where there is uncertainty about the biological relationship between an individual and their aunt or uncle, avuncular testing can provide concrete evidence to support or refute claims of kinship This can be particularly important in cases where there are disputes over inheritance rights or custody of a child.

The results of avuncular DNA testing are presented in a report that indicates the likelihood of a biological relationship between the tested individuals The report will typically include a statistical probability of relatedness, which can help individuals and legal professionals understand the strength of the genetic evidence While avuncular testing cannot provide conclusive proof of a biological relationship, it can offer valuable insights and support claims of kinship in various situations.

It is important to note that avuncular DNA testing is more complex than standard paternity testing and may require additional samples from other relatives to establish a reliable result In some cases, testing the DNA of both the aunt and uncle may be necessary to confirm a biological relationship with the niece or nephew Working with a reputable and accredited DNA testing lab is crucial to ensure the accuracy and reliability of the results.
